Stefan Gäth
About
Stefan Gäth has authored 31 papers that have received a total of 813 indexed citations.
This includes 13 papers in Pollution, 8 papers in Civil and Structural Engineering and 8 papers in Soil Science. The topics of these papers are Heavy metals in environment (8 papers), Soil and Unsaturated Flow (7 papers) and Toxic Organic Pollutants Impact (5 papers). Stefan Gäth is often cited by papers focused on Heavy metals in environment (8 papers), Soil and Unsaturated Flow (7 papers) and Toxic Organic Pollutants Impact (5 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Luxembourg and The Netherlands. Stefan Gäth's co-authors include Rolf‐Alexander Düring, Andreas Horn, Ramchandra Bhandari, Felix Mayer and Hans‐Georg Frede and has published in prestigious journals such as Environmental Science & Technology, The Science of The Total Environment and Journal of Environmental Management.
